The Influence of the Work Environment and Work Discipline on Elementary Teachers’ Performance

This study aims to analyse the effect of the work environment and work discipline on the elementary teachers’ performance. The source of data in this study was elementary teachers from Dumai, Riau province, Indonesia. The data of this study were obtained from the distribution of questionnaires to 166 elementary teachers who were selected using random sampling technique. Data analysis used multiple regression analysis. The results showed that individually and collectively work environment and work discipline had an effect on elementary teachers’ performance. A comfortable work environment and a high level of work discipline will improve teacher performance. Thus, it can be concluded that the variables of work environment and work discipline on teacher performance have a positive influence.
